Ekiti plans 10 million cocoa seedlings in 10 years

The Ekiti State Government has said it will raise 10 million cocoa seedlings over the next 10 years as part of efforts to revive cocoa production and restore the state’s position in Nigeria’s cocoa value chain. Ekiti L-PRES mobilises 35 inoculators for livestock vaccination

The Ekiti State Livestock Productivity and Resilience Support (L-PRES) Project has mobilised no fewer than 35 inoculators for a statewide vaccination exercise to combat transboundary animal diseases and safeguard livestock production. The stakeholders’ meeting held in Ado Ekiti brought together key actors in the livestock sector to strategise on effective vaccine distribution and administration across the state.
